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Beuggen to Basel SBB Station is to drive which costs SFr 3 - SFr 6 and takes 18 min.
The fastest way to get from Beuggen to Basel SBB Station is to drive which takes 18 min and costs SFr 3 - SFr 6.
The distance between Beuggen and Basel SBB Station is 23 km. The road distance is 22.4 km.
The best way to get from Beuggen to Basel SBB Station without a car is to line 7312 bus and train which takes 49 min and costs SFr 4 - SFr 21.
It takes approximately 49 min to get from Beuggen to Basel SBB Station,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Beuggen to Basel SBB Station is 22 km. It takes approximately 18 min to drive from Beuggen to Basel SBB Station.

What companies run services between Beuggen, Germany and Basel SBB Station, Switzerland?
There is no direct connection from Beuggen to Basel SBB Station. However, you can take the line 7312 bus to Rheinfelden, walk to Rheinfelden, then take the train to Basel SBB.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Beuggen Bahnhof to Basel, Bahnhof SBB via Rheinfelden Busbahnhof, Rheinfelden, Basel Bad Bf, and Basel, Badischer Bahnhof in around 57 min.
